What Exactly is Cocopeat? A Gardener’s Primer

Cocopeat is a 100% natural growing medium made from the pith of a coconut husk. This spongy, lightweight material is a byproduct of the coconut coir industry. Once considered waste, it’s now celebrated for its remarkable properties that create an ideal environment for plant roots to thrive. For any gardener, this is the perfect answer to “what is cocopeat.”

The Journey from Coconut Husk to Garden Gold

The process begins after farmers harvest coconuts. Workers separate the outer husk and remove the long fibers to make ropes, mats, and other coir products. This process leaves behind the dusty, pithy material known as cocopeat. Processors then wash, dry, and sometimes buffer this raw material to create the high-quality growing medium available to gardeners.

Washed vs. Unwashed vs. Buffered: A Critical Choice

Understanding the types of this medium is crucial for success. Unwashed coir can contain high levels of sodium and potassium, which can harm plants. High-quality products are thoroughly washed to remove these excess salts.

Buffered cocopeat goes a step further. Producers treat it with a calcium solution to displace sodium and prevent nutrient lockout. This is a common issue where the coir holds onto calcium and magnesium, making them unavailable to the plant.

Understanding the Different Forms: Blocks, Bricks, and Loose Mix

This versatile medium is most commonly sold in compressed blocks or bricks, which are dehydrated and easy to transport and store. When you add water, they expand to several times their original volume. You can also find it in a ready-to-use, loose form, often pre-mixed with other amendments like perlite or vermiculite.

How to Prepare and Use Cocopeat Like a Pro (Step-by-Step)

Using a compressed block for the first time is a satisfying experience. The transformation from a hard brick to a fluffy growing medium is remarkable. Here’s how to do it correctly.

Step 1: Rehydrating a Cocopeat Block

Place your compressed brick in a large container, like a wheelbarrow or a sturdy tub. Add the recommended amount of warm water (check the packaging). A 5 kg block typically needs about 25 liters (6-7 gallons) of water. Let it sit for 15-30 minutes, watching as it absorbs the water and swells. Break the rehydrated material apart with your hands or a small shovel until there are no lumps.

Step 2: Creating the Perfect Potting Mix

While excellent, this fibrous material alone is not a complete potting mix as it contains few native nutrients. You must amend it to provide food for your plants. A classic, all-purpose recipe is:

  • 60% Cocopeat
  • 40% Perlite or Vermiculite (for added aeration)
  • A balanced, slow-release fertilizer or compost/worm castings

This mixture provides the perfect balance of water retention, drainage, and initial nutrition for most container plants. While some agricultural byproducts like 椰干粉棕榈仁压榨机 serve as animal feed, for gardening, coir pith is the star.

Step 3: Tips for Amending Garden Soil

This coconut byproduct is also a phenomenal soil conditioner. If you have heavy clay soil, mixing in coir pith will improve drainage and aeration. In sandy soil, it will significantly improve water and nutrient retention. To apply, spread a 2-3 inch layer over your garden bed and till it into the top 6-8 inches of soil.

What is Cocopeat Best For? Top Applications

The versatility of coir pith makes it suitable for a wide range of gardening and horticultural uses. Its unique properties shine in specific applications:

  • Hydroponics and Soilless Farming

    Cocopeat is a world-class substrate for hydroponics. Its inert nature means it won’t interfere with the nutrient solution you provide. The excellent water retention and aeration create the perfect root zone for plants like tomatoes, cucumbers, and peppers grown without soil.

  • Seed Starting and Propagation

    Because it’s sterile and provides consistent moisture, this medium is ideal for germinating seeds and rooting cuttings. The fine texture allows delicate new roots to establish themselves easily without fighting through compacted soil.

  • Container Gardening and Potted Plants

    This is perhaps its most popular use. For indoor and outdoor potted plants, a coir-based mix prevents the soil from becoming waterlogged or drying out too quickly—the two biggest challenges of container gardening.

  • Amending Clay or Sandy Soils

    As a soil amendment, it works wonders. It breaks up heavy, dense clay, improving its structure and drainage. In loose, sandy soil, it adds body and dramatically increases its ability to hold onto the water and nutrients that would otherwise wash away.

Common Mistakes to Avoid with Cocopeat (2026 Update)

While powerful, this growing medium is not foolproof. Understanding its unique characteristics helps you avoid common pitfalls that can frustrate new users.

The Danger of High Salinity in Unwashed Coir

The number one mistake is using cheap, unwashed coir. Coconuts are often grown near coastlines, so their husks can absorb a lot of salt. As noted by university agricultural extensions like the University of Florida, high salinity will pull moisture out of your plant’s roots, effectively killing them.

Always buy from a reputable supplier who guarantees low EC (Electrical Conductivity) levels, which is a measure of salt content.

Nutrient Deficiencies: The Calcium and Magnesium Issue

As mentioned, coir has a high Cation Exchange Capacity (CEC) and a natural affinity for calcium and magnesium. If you use an unbuffered medium with standard fertilizers, the coir itself can absorb these crucial nutrients. This leads to deficiencies in your plants (e.g., blossom end rot in tomatoes).

Using a cal-mag supplement, buffered coir, or specialized nutrients like 棕榈油脂肪酸钙盐 for certain applications can solve this problem.

[Image: A photo of a tomato plant with yellowing leaves and blossom end rot, contrasted with a healthy plant. Title: Signs of Nutrient Lockout to Avoid. Alt Text: A plant showing yellow leaves, a common sign of nutrient deficiency when using unbuffered cocopeat.]

Overwatering: A Common Misconception

Because it holds so much water, you must adjust your watering schedule. The top may look dry, but the medium can still be very moist just an inch below the surface. Always check with your finger before watering again.

Even with its excellent aeration, overwatering can still lead to root rot. Good drainage is key, so ensure your pots have holes.

关于椰糠的常见问题

椰糠对所有植物都适用吗?

It is excellent for most plants, especially those that thrive in consistently moist but well-drained soil. However, for succulents and cacti that require very dry conditions, you should use it sparingly and mix it with a high percentage of drainage materials like sand or pumice.

椰糠基质的植物应该多久浇一次水?

Significantly less often than with traditional soil. A good rule is to check the moisture level 1-2 inches below the surface. Only water when it begins to feel dry to the touch. The frequency will depend on the plant, pot size, and environmental conditions.

Can I reuse this growing medium?

Absolutely. It breaks down very slowly and can be reused for 2-4 years. After a growing season, you can remove the old root ball, fluff up the coir, amend it with fresh compost or fertilizer, and replant. This makes it a very cost-effective and sustainable option.

Does cocopeat contain any nutrients?

No, it is an inert medium with very few nutrients. This is an advantage as it gives you full control over your plant’s nutrition. You must add nutrients through compost, worm castings, or a balanced liquid or slow-release fertilizer program for healthy plant growth.

What is the difference between cocopeat and coco coir?

Coco coir is the general term for the fibrous material from the coconut husk. It includes long fibers, short fibers, and the pithy dust in between. Cocopeat specifically refers to this pithy, dust-like material which has been processed into a growing medium.
